EN50155 Ethernet Switch

Up to 6-port 10G Copper / Q-ODC Fiber Uplinks

Lantech 10G EN50155 Ethernet switch is a high performance L2+ Managed Ethernet switch with up to 16 10/100/1000T M12 connectors + up to 6 10G copper / Q-ODC fiber uplinks which provides L2 wire speed and advanced security function for 10G network aggregation deployment.

Up to 16 PoE at/af Ports with Advanced PoE Management

Compliant with 802.3af/at standard, the Lantech 10G EN50155 Ethernet switch is able to feed each PoE port up to 30 Watt. The Ethernet switch supports advanced PoE management including PoE detection and scheduling. PoE detection can detect if the connected PD hangs then restart the PD; PoE scheduling is to allow pre-set power feeding schedule upon routine time table. Each PoE ports can be Enabled/disabled, get the voltage, current, Watt, and temperature info displayed on WebUI.

Optional Smart Bypass Protection on 10G Ports

The bypass relay is set to bypass the switch to the next one when power is off to prevent network disruption. Lantech bypass caters to remain in bypass mode until the switch is completely booting up when power is back to avoid another network lost. Smart bypass can be activated when switch is hanged or LTDP time out.

Innovative LTDP** (Link Train Discovery Protocol) to Assign Proper IP Address when Car Changes as well as Inherit Configuration in Replaced Switch

With port-based DHCP server, LTDP** allows Lantech EN50155 switch series in single ring discover the current IP addresses and ensure the replaced switch to assign the same IP address and configuration based on location.

Miss-Wiring Avoidance, Repowered Auto Ring** Restore, Loop Protection

Lantech 10G EN50155 Ethernet switch also embedded several features for strong and reliable network protection in an easy and intuitive way. When the pre-set ring configuration failed or looped by miss-wiring, the Ethernet switch is able to alert with the LED indicator and disable ring automatically. Repowered auto ring restore function (node failure protection) ensures the switches in a ring to survive after power breakout is back. The status can be shown in NMS when each switch is back. Loop protection is also available to prevent the generation of broadcast storm when a dumb switch is inserted in a closed loop connection.

EN50155 Ethernet SwitchSupports Optional PXE / BootP to Boot-Up Switch with Latest or Certain Firmware

It supports optional PXE / BootP protocol that can boot up switch with latest or certain firmware obtaining from the server and act as DHCP option 82 or Port based DHCP function to offer the same IP addresses on port base or VLAN base to devices.

DHCP Option 82 & Port Based, Mac Based DHCP, Option66, IPv6 DHCP Server**

DHCP option 82 and Port based DHCP function can offer the same IP address on port base or VLAN base where there is need to replace the new device connecting to Lantech switches to avoid any network disruption. The built-in DHCP Option 82 server offers the convenience of policy setting on the switch. Mac based DHCP server function assigns an IP address according to its MAC address to include dumb switches in DHCP network. DHCP option 66 is also supported. Optional IPv6 address resolution for DHCP server can be supported.

User Friendly GUI, Auto Topology Drawing

The user friendly UI, innovative auto topology drawing and topology demo makes Lantech 10G EN50155 Ethernet switch much easier to get hands-on. The complete CLI enables professional engineer to configure setting by command line.

Enhanced G.8032 Ring, 8/16**MSTI MSTP; MRP Ring

Lantech 10G EN50155 Ethernet switch features enhanced G.8032 ring which can be self-healed in less than 20ms for single ring topology protection covering multicast packets. It also supports various ring topologies that covers double ring, multi-chain (under enhanced ring), train ring**, basic ring, multiple-VLAN ring** and auto-ring** by easy setup than others. The innovative auto-Ring** configurator (auto mode**) can calculate owner and neighbor in one step. It supports MSTP that allows RSTP over VLAN for redundant links with 8/16** MSTI. MRP (Media Redundancy Protocol) can be supported for industrial automation networks.

QinQ*, QoS and GVRP Supported

It supports the QinQ*, QoS, GVRP for large VLAN segmentation.

IGMPv3, GMRP, Router Port, Static Multicast Forwarding and Multicast Ring Protection

The unique multicast protection under enhanced G.8032 ring can offer immediate self-recovery instead of waiting for IGMP table timeout. It also supports IGMPv3, GMRP, router port and static multicast forwarding binding by ports for video surveillance application.

Editable Configuration File; USB Port for Upload/Download Configuration; InstaView** for Mass Deployment

The configuration file of Lantech 10G EN50155 Ethernet switch can be exported and edited with word processor for the other switches configuration with ease. The USB port can upload/download the configuration from/to USB dongle. With optional InstaView, the configuration files can be mass backup, mass-editable deployed and auto upgrading firmware in batch make maintenance easy.

Event Log & Message; 2 DI + 2DO; Factory Default Button

In case of event, the 10G EN50155 Ethernet switch is able to send an email** & SMS** text message to pre-defined addresses as well as SNMP Traps out immediately. It provides 2DI and 2DO. When disconnection of the specific port was detected; DO will activate the signal LED to alarm. DI can integrate the sensors for events and DO will trigger the alarm while sending alert information to IP network with email and traps. The factory reset button can restore the setting back to factory default.

Environmental Monitoring for Switch Inside Information

The environmental monitoring can detect switch overall temperature, total PoE load, voltage and current where can send the SNMP traps, email** and SMS** alert when abnormal.

Dual WV Input with Max PoE Budget

The WV model of 10G EN50155 Ethernet switch accept 16.8~137.5VDC dual input and can feed 54V output for PoE feeding at max 120W PoE budget. WVI model accept 16.8~137.5VDC dual input and can feed 54V output for PoE feeding with max 80W budget.

EN50155, EN45545-2, EN61373 Verification; IEC 61375-2-5 Compliance*; High ESD Protection

The 10G EN50155 Ethernet switch also provides ±2000V EFT and ±6000V ESD contact protection, which can reduce unstable situation caused by power line and Ethernet. Lantech Ethernet switch passed serious tests under extensive Industrial EMI and Safety standards. With EN45545-2 Fire & Smoke, EN50155 verification and IEC 61375-2-5 compliance, the Ethernet switch is best switch for railway on-board/track side, vehicle and mining applications. For more usage flexibilities, the Ethernet switch supports wide operating temperature from -40°C to 75°C.
